Designed and delivered multiple production-ready modules for gaming and fintech applications across DEV, UAT, and PROD environments, using React, Node.js, and SQL, ensuring smooth feature deployments.
Reduced API latency by 90% in a real-time battleship-style game by implementing asynchronous job processing with BullMQ and Redis caching, improving in-game responsiveness from 2.5 seconds to 200ms.
Built a high-availability fantasy sports platform (“FUTY”) for 2K+ users using React, TailwindCSS, and AWS S3 + CloudFront, achieving sub-200ms asset delivery via CDN.
Refactored the core AWS S3 integration to support MinIO-compatible endpoints, enabling the use of self-hosted object storage for cost savings and data control.
Developed a robust loan management system with Node.js, React, and SQL, incorporating form validations, transaction tracking, and error handling to reduce loan tracking errors by 35%.
Mentored junior developers through code reviews, pair programming, and debugging sessions, improving overall team code quality and reducing bug recurrence.
Collaborated with cross-functional teams via Agile sprints and Jira tracking, ensuring clear requirements and delivering product features on time in over 95% of sprints.
Architected and developed a loan management & collection system using Java, Spring Boot, and MongoDB, deploying it across DEV, UAT, and PROD environments, processed 1,000+ loan applications and accounts post launch.
Implemented push notification scheduling using Cron jobs and batch processing to remind employees about daily tasks, improving timely task completion by 80%.
Optimized MongoDB performance by simplifying and restructuring the schema for maintainability while meeting business requirements, resulting in easier query handling and reduced development complexity.
Reduced MongoDB query response times by 70% through aggregation pipeline optimization, strategic indexing, and schema tuning, significantly improving API response times.
Participated in Agile sprints by contributing to sprint planning, backlog discussions, and peer code reviews, helping ensure timely delivery of planned features in a fast-paced environment.
Java
Spring Boot
MongoDB
AWS
My Past Work
Disaster Data API
Aug 2024
Real-time system designed to collect, process, and distribute media content related to natural disasters from social media platforms and distribute using HTTP protocol.
Java
Spring Boot
Hibernate
PostgreSQL
eWallet
July 2024
Aims to perform operations like a real e-wallet applications like PayTM. Transfer funds from one user to another, deposit and withdraw funds from external banks.
TypeScript
Next.js
PostgreSQL
Node.js
Sway
June 2024
Streamline access to educational content from YouTube. Users can search for topics that they want to study, and the app will provide curated subtopics with relevant YouTube videos.
Developed a UI clone of 'spacex.com' using raw CSS and JavaScript. Created interactive and visually appealing animations to closely match the official 'spacex.com' site.
JavaScript
CSS
HTML
My Tech Stack
I apply my knowledge of different technologies to deliver practical solutions across multiple platforms